/*#mainnav li { float:left; padding-left:3px; font-weight:bold; font-family:Verdana, Arial, Helvetica, sans-serif; font-size:11px; }
#mainnav li a { display:block; background-color:#c8cf7f; color:#FFFFFF; text-decoration:none; padding:0px 10px 2px 11px; line-height:19px; }
#mainnav li a:hover { background-color:#d5bddc; color:#FFFFFF; text-decoration:none; }*/
#mainnav td { text-align:center; font-weight:bold; font-family:Verdana, Arial, Helvetica, sans-serif; font-size:11px; }
#mainnav td a { display:block; background-color:#c8cf7f; color:#FFFFFF; text-decoration:none; padding:0px 10px 2px 10px; }
#mainnav td a:hover, #mainnav td a.active { color:#000000; text-decoration:none; } 
#sidecontent { border-top:3px solid #84325e; border-right:1px solid #ffffff; background-color:#eaf2f0; margin-top:1px; padding:10px 5px 15px 10px; color:#982c4a; }
#sidecontent h2 { color:#982c4a;  padding-bottom:0px;  }
#sidecontent ul { padding-top:14px; line-height:14px; }
.highlight { color:#85325c; }
.highlightbold { color:#85325c; font-weight:bold; }
.greyhightlight { color:#969696; font-weight:bold; font-size:11px; }
#pageheading { color:#a7ae4d; border-bottom:1px solid #eaf2f0; padding-bottom:8px; margin-bottom:8px; } 
.flogos { margin-bottom:14px; padding-left:8px; }
.more {
	display:block;
	width:91px;
	height:23px;
	background-image: url(../images/bg_more.gif);
	background-repeat: no-repeat;
	background-position:0px 0px;
}
.more:hover { background-position:0px -23px; }

.new-icon {
font-size: 8px;
font-weight:bold;
color: #86325E;
}

#calendar-link {
float: right;
position: absolute;
margin-left: 130px;
margin-top: 0px;
display: block;
width: 80px;
height: 50px;
/*margin-top: -20px;
position: fixed;
margin-left: 130px;*/
}
